    Endoscopic submucosal dissection (ESD) results in high en-bloc resection rate. Male, 80 years old, two sessile polyps of 20 mm and 40 mm in the cecum (JNET 2A).A solution of carmine and adrenalin was injected, followed by mucosal incision. In the first, conventional submucosal dissection, the scar was closed with clips. In the second, submucosal dissection was performed by traction method.Histology revealed that the first was hyperplasic. The second was adenomatous, high grade dysplasia, negative margins.This case demonstrates ESD at the cecum. ESD has the potential to become the common therapy for large superficial colorectal sessile tumors.
